The rules of life often came to me as a child in homespun adages plucked from the Bible or Ben Franklin. I was reared on phrases that could encourage or reprimand—time-honored words that held a weightiness greater than individual beliefs. They bore the wisdom of history and sages. “Still waters run deep.” My mother would affirm in defense of my father’s taciturn manner. “Every cloud has a silver lining,” I’d be reassured in times of disappointment.
